Dastaan has taken the Leeds culinary scene by storm!

Award-winning dynamic duo, Indian restaurateurs Nand Kishor and Sanjay Gour promised and delivered a Mayfair fine-dining experience at a fraction of the price.

Nand and Sanjay are experienced chefs. Sanjay was pastry chef at Angela Hartnett’s Murano and both were head chefs at the Michelin starred Gymkhana.

They have used their extensive experience to create in Leeds, something simpler than the high-flying Mayfair restaurant, curating a well considered menu of authentic dishes which are fresh, vibrant and authentic to Dastaan.

You can expect a range of dishes from across the Indian subcontinent, including one of India’s most popular snacks, panipuri, and some unusual additions such as Tandoori broccoli and duck and guinea fowl seekh kebab. Diners will also find a selection of seafood dishes including lobster and prawn dosa, and Malvani fish curry. Beers come from local favourites Kirkstall Brewery, as well as a small but well-curated wine and cocktail menu, with a few options for non-drinkers too.

Anurag Singh who operates Dastaan Leeds says “The team felt that coming to Leeds was “the obvious choice, the food scene is really good”, and he feels that Dastaan will be a welcome addition to Leeds rich culinary landscape, offering a fine dining experience at a fraction of the price.

Dastaan has also now launched its first bottomless brunch offering, available Saturday and Sunday from noon to 2pm. The street food menu includes aloo tikki chaat, dahi puri, cheese and onion dosa, pulled duck dosa, paneer chilli or chicken Kathi rolls and tandoori chicken. Priced at £35pp, the food is paired with unlimited prosecco, cocktails, beer, IPA and wines for a sitting of 90 minutes.

Award-winning Indian restaurateurs Nand Kishor and Sanjay Gour who took London and Surrey by storm in 2017 have now opened their second restaurant in affluent suburbs of Leeds with Anurag Singh at the helm.

Kishor and Gour made their names in the position of Head Chef at the critically acclaimed Michelin-starred Gymkhana restaurant in Mayfair. Dastaan restaurant in Epsom, features in Michelin Guide, Hardens, AA Guide, Good food Guide and has won numerous other accolades. In its first year, it was awarded a Bib Gourmand by the Michelin Guide and has retained it ever since. The Guardian described it as “food of the subcontinent elevated way beyond its uninspiring location – Mayfair cooking at mundane prices”.

Dastaan Leeds is a beautiful restaurant with 140 seats over 2 floors. It has room for private events with separate bar. Along with a concise and punchy food menu it also offers an impressive drinks menu. The restaurant was one of the finalists for best newcomer category in the prestigious British Curry Awards 2022.

Indian food fans can indulge in dishes that showcase the rich tapestry of the sub-continent; authentic regional dishes with an innovative, modern twist. The menu has expanded on the popular offerings and it includes dishes like Tellichery Lobster dose, Salli Keema Pav & Kurkuri Bhindi. just to name a few.
